- Sign on Bonus for eligible positionsMajor Responsibilities:
- Prepares and rooms the patient for exam by obtaining vital
signs and gathering/documenting/updating pertinent health
information (i.e. chief complaint, allergies, and/or
medications).
- Performs laboratory procedures (i.e. strep test, wound culture,
specimen collection, etc.) using principles of aseptic technique
and standard precautions/infection control guidelines.
- Assists the physician/advance practice provider (APP) with
procedures and surgeries such as pelvic exams, allergy scratch
testing, EMG, cautery, colposcopy, etc.
- Administers routine medications, under physician/APP orders,
which may include but are not limited to immunizations,
antibiotics, vitamins and topical agents.
- Provides basic patient instructions on the performance of
routine tasks or skills. Follows through with necessary procedure
or test requests, pre-approved care algorithms, new appointment
times and referrals to other facilities or services. Refers
questions to registered nurses and physicians/providers per scope
of practice guidelines and relays information back to patient as
directed.
- Communicates with physicians and other members of the health
care team to ensure smooth clinic flow and makes adjustments as
necessary. Effectively communicates accurate and timely information
with the patient.
- May perform basic and advanced clinical support tasks or skills
based on the specialty and appropriate advanced skills and
competencies such as but not limited to removal of sutures and
staples, straight catheterization, audiograms, laboratory
procedures (throat/nose culture, drug screen), phlebotomy -
butterfly, venous heel stick, EKG, spirometry, Holter monitor
application, etc., under clinical supervision.
